GENDER INCLUSION THROUGH AI-DRIVEN TECHNOLOGY: BREAKING BARRIERS AND BRIDGING GAPS

Abstract

Artificial Intelligence (AI) is rapidly transforming educational systems worldwide. Accordingly, this paper explores how AI-driven technology education can promote gender inclusion by breaking down historical barriers and creating equitable access to learning opportunities. Specifically, it reviewed the effects of AI on women's empowerment in the in the society today with a bias for core Northern states in Nigeria. It critically examines the challenges women face in technology education and STEM as well as evaluates how AI can serve as a tool to bridge the digital and gender divide. It probes into AI's capacity to close gender gaps, enhance technical education and to promote gender parity by recommending ways to achieve gender inclusion in line with global best practices that support inclusive AI-enhanced education. The paper took the part of examining few case studies and initiatives which underscore the potential benefits and hurdles associated with AI in propelling gender inclusion and women empowerment. The results indicate that while AI holds promise for advancing women's empowerment, it necessitates diligent efforts to mitigate biases and uphold inclusivity.
